Death of Dan Krehbiel
 

Dan passed on the 23rd. He was a long time member of the E.F.V8 C. and the clubs advisor for 1939-41 Mercury as well as Columbia two speeds . Dan also rebuilt Columbia rear axle assemblies. He was a friend to many, including myself, and will be very much missed. God Bless!
